The use of polishing cloths are helpful in cleaning your jewelry. With this method, you can simply shine it up and not deal with the hassle of using cleaners. You just have to polish each piece the same as you would polish glass using the two-sided cloth. Use a two-sided cloth to clean your jewelry, one for polishing, and the other for shining.
Keep your jewelry in a relatively air-tight container, and minimize its exposure to humidity. Trying putting them in a box with a tight-fitting lid or a bag that has a drawstring closure. Air and humidity can cause the metals that the jewelry are made of to tarnish. Precious metal jewelry can be polished to fix tarnish, but non-precious metals coated with a finish will never get back to their previous state.
If you are shopping for sterling silver jewelry, you’ll need a magnet and an eye for the real thing. Use the magnet to detect fake jewelry; real silver will not be attracted to the magnet, but the cheaper metals will. Sterling silver should always bear a stamp that says Sterling, Ster. or .925. If the item has no markings indicating its authenticity, then be wary.

When you are purchasing a new piece of jewelry, be aware of the gemstone that it contains and what it is made of. A stone may be natural, synthetic or imitation. “Real” can mean natural or synthetic, and an imitation stone could be glass or plastic. The difference here, however, is that synthetic is man-made in a laboratory while natural is found buried in the earth.

Ask the jeweler what type of insurance is available for your purchase. These policies dictate whether or not the jeweler will replace or fix your item of jewelry if it is damaged. In some cases, insurance policies will cover lost, misplaced or stolen pieces.

If you can prevent your jewelry from tarnishing, it will surely look much more attractive. Don’t take your jewelry into the water, regardless of whether you are showering or hitting the beach. If you let some metals get wet too often, they can tarnish, rust or become dull. A single coat of transparent nail polish may help protect certain types of metal.

One way to ensure that your jewelry stays clean is to put it only after you have applied your make-up and it has had time to set. The grime and dust in makeup are attracted to the jewelry, and if you put on the jewelry before the cosmetics, it can cause the pieces to look dull. This is particularly important in the case of necklaces and earrings.
